对于ubuntu的mysql, 真的是非常的麻烦,就是关于root用户无法访问的问题,解决了
mysql安装过程:
===========================================================================================================================================
1:安装
sudo apt-get install mysql-server
2:安装的过程中,(如果你是第一次安装,就会让你输入root的密码) 输入了密码也没有用,安装完了,还是进不去
正常的过程是直接
mysql -u root -p (回车)然后输入密码,可是还是进不去。
mysql_install_db
/etc/init.d/mysql restart
然后重新给root分配密码, 因为我们上面把mysql的数据库删了,所以密码也没有了,所以现在可以用mysqladmin这个数据库管理工具,重新给root用户创建一个密码
mysqladmin -u root password xxxxx
4:现在可以创建一个给wordpress 用的数据库了
create database wordpress
然后创建一个给wp用的用户,加上密码
create user wordpressuser@localhost
set password for wordpressuser@localhost=password("huangtao")
最后使wordpressuser用户 拥有操作wordpress数据的权力
grant all privileges on wordpress.* to wordpressuser@localhost
flush privileges;
exit
====================================================================================================================================
安装apache2:
sudo apt-get install apache2
安装php与mysql 操作接口:
apt-get install php5-mysql
=============================================================================
下载wordpress
wget http://wordpress.org/latest.tar.gz
解压后,修改wp-config.php文件,填上我们创建的数据库,用户名和密码
然后cp到root websites ,后面就是可以直接在browser中进行安装了
====================================================================================================================================
mysql安装过程:
===========================================================================================================================================
1:安装
sudo apt-get install mysql-server
2:安装的过程中,(如果你是第一次安装,就会让你输入root的密码) 输入了密码也没有用,安装完了,还是进不去
正常的过程是直接
mysql -u root -p (回车)然后输入密码,可是还是进不去。
3:解决办法:直接把下面的mysql/目录下面的文件全删了,然后重新安全数据库,然后重启mysql
(这种方法会把之数据库mysql中的所有数据删掉,注意备份之前的数据)
rm -rf /var/lib/mysql/*mysql_install_db
/etc/init.d/mysql restart
然后重新给root分配密码, 因为我们上面把mysql的数据库删了,所以密码也没有了,所以现在可以用mysqladmin这个数据库管理工具,重新给root用户创建一个密码
mysqladmin -u root password xxxxx
4:现在可以创建一个给wordpress 用的数据库了
create database wordpress
然后创建一个给wp用的用户,加上密码
create user wordpressuser@localhost
set password for wordpressuser@localhost=password("huangtao")
最后使wordpressuser用户 拥有操作wordpress数据的权力
grant all privileges on wordpress.* to wordpressuser@localhost
flush privileges;
exit
====================================================================================================================================
安装apache2:
sudo apt-get install apache2
安装php与mysql 操作接口:
apt-get install php5-mysql
=============================================================================
下载wordpress
wget http://wordpress.org/latest.tar.gz
解压后,修改wp-config.php文件,填上我们创建的数据库,用户名和密码
然后cp到root websites ,后面就是可以直接在browser中进行安装了
====================================================================================================================================